Embera Indigenous Culture Tour
Hop on a boat and sail to the Embera Indians community in the Chagres River. Visit the community located in the Chagres National Park, take a rainforest tour to a waterfall, admire their homes, dances and customs. Share a traditional indigenous style lunch and do not miss the chance to buy their handicrafts.
You should wear comfortable clothes and walking shoes (recommended trekking shoes), swimsuit, towel, a change of clothes and sunscreen.
